President Akuffo Addo has promised each player of the Black Satellites $10,000 for their triumph at the 2021 AFCON U-20 tournament. The Black Satellites defeated the Young Cranes of Uganda 2-0 in the finals of the 2021 U-20 AFCON to win Ghana’s fourth trophy in the competition’s history. One week after the Covid-19 vaccination kick-started in the Ashanti Region, a little over 45 percent of the 231,000 vaccine shots allocated for 15 municipalities and districts has been duly administered.
